I recently stayed at The Cox Today, one of the most talked-about hotels in Cox’s Bazar. While the hotel presents itself as a 5-star property, my experience was somewhat mixed. The staff was friendly and helpful, which made a positive difference, and the complimentary breakfast was decent, although the variety of dishes was limited compared to other hotels in the area. However, several things fell short of expectations. The washroom amenities were lacking no hand wash, no comb, and poor ventilation without any air freshener. There was no prayer mat in the room until we specifically asked for one. The TV was not a smart TV, which felt outdated for a hotel claiming to be 5-star. Due to the rain, the floor remained damp, making the room feel quite uncomfortable. Overall, the hotel has potential, but without improvements in room facilities and more attention to detail, their reputation could suffer. I hope the management takes this feedback constructively, as a few thoughtful upgrades could truly align their services with the 5-star experience they advertise.

This is an old property.
The breakfast arrangement is terrible. Many tourists as well as us had to wait to find a table. They arrange breakfast at a underground restaurant, which looks like old model weeding hall. Food variety and tastes are very poor.
Location, not beachfront and this is the only hotel on that road. The architecture of the hotel exterior is great, but when you enter you will be disappointed as find every setup looks old.
Pool, they have a nice pool outside.
